|
|
#16 |
|
Reader of Books
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 249
Karma: 178096
Join Date: Oct 2012
Device: Kobo Libra Colour, Clara Colour, Libra 2, Elipsa
|
I copied the example text in the fbink thread since I don't know what I'm doing
. That did indeed work just fineSpoiler:
Where should that strace file be placed on the kindle, because /mnt/us/ directory did not appear to be the answer. Should it be replacing the one in the usbnet directory? |
|
|
|
|
|
#17 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
@7hir7een: You can basically put it anywhere, as long as you call that one, and not USBNet's.
I usually put those kind of testing things in root's $HOME, since it's a tmpfs, but in this specific case, replacing USBNet's binary is a good idea, since that one is mostly broken on the KOA2 anyway . And then you can just call "strace" since USBNet's one is in your PATH .EDIT: Just to be perfectly clear: you did get to see that string printed on your screen, right? ^^. That'd be a good news, since KOReader should mostly do the same thing... EDIT²: Err, of course, you have to unpack the tarball, first . tar xvzf strace-koa2.tar.gz .
Last edited by NiLuJe; 06-25-2018 at 02:01 PM. |
|
|
|
|
|
#18 |
|
Reader of Books
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 249
Karma: 178096
Join Date: Oct 2012
Device: Kobo Libra Colour, Clara Colour, Libra 2, Elipsa
|
ssh output attached
Actions taken: (roughly, some button presses had to be repeated because this slowed down the device a lot and it appeared not to be responding) Spoiler:
And yes, the text did print on the screen (screenshot attached) ETA: If you would like me to take less actions in a specific order, just let me know. I was trying to do a bit of everything haha |
|
|
|
|
|
#19 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
@7hir7een: Thanks! That'll give me something to check against, I'll keep you all posted
.
|
|
|
|
|
|
#20 |
|
Wizard
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 1,251
Karma: 2957301
Join Date: Apr 2014
Location: Rochester, NY
Device: Boox Go 10.3, Kobo Libra 2
|
Thanks @NiLuJe & 7hir7een! I haven't had a chance to get started on USBNet yet.
|
|
|
|
|
|
#21 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
Okay, I'll be merging the KOReader changes soon, in the meantime, just to check that I did not break anything, could one of you check if the newly released FBInk 0.9.12 still works?
|
|
|
|
|
|
#22 |
|
Reader of Books
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 249
Karma: 178096
Join Date: Oct 2012
Device: Kobo Libra Colour, Clara Colour, Libra 2, Elipsa
|
It does indeed
|
|
|
|
|
|
#23 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
Yay, thanks!
I'll give you a shout once an OTA w/ the latest changes pops up .
|
|
|
|
|
|
#24 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
@7hir7een: In the meantime, I guess I can ask you a few more things to try...
![]() Does Code:
hexdump /dev/input/by-path/platform-gpiokey.0-event ]).If it works, tap a few times on each physical buttons and send me the output (again, in a specific order so I can figure out which is which ^^). ---- And the final thing: does it still rotate automatically based on its physical orientation? If yes, does Code:
lipc-get-prop -s com.lab126.winmgr accelerometer And if it does, what about Code:
cat /proc/bus/input/devices | grep -e 'Handlers\\|EV=' | grep -B1 'EV=d'| grep -o 'event[0-9]' With that answered, I should be able to match the KOA1 feature-set .
Last edited by NiLuJe; 07-01-2018 at 07:46 AM. |
|
|
|
|
|
#25 |
|
Reader of Books
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 249
Karma: 178096
Join Date: Oct 2012
Device: Kobo Libra Colour, Clara Colour, Libra 2, Elipsa
|
Sure thing
![]() The first bit of code returns a file not found Code:
[root@kindle root]# hexdump /dev/input/by-path/platform-gpiokey.0-event hexdump: /dev/input/by-path/platform-gpiokey.0-event: No such file or directory Spoiler:
That's top, bottom, top, bottom (spaces inserted for legibility) -- with the device upright (buttons on right side) --- Here are the other things you asked for if you still need them: by-path Spoiler:
devices Spoiler:
--- Yes, the KOA2 retains the accelerometer. Switching between upright (buttons on right side) and reversed (buttons on left side): Spoiler:
But that second bit Spoiler:
Last edited by 7hir7een; 07-01-2018 at 09:07 AM. Reason: added platform-gpio-keys-event results; fixed typo; answer question in order |
|
|
|
|
|
#26 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
@7hir7een: Thanks, that was massively helpful
. I should be able to get the physical buttons working, as well as the orientaiton support with all this .And the final command failing can be explained by the fact that there's >9 input devices, but I should be able to figure it out thanks to the manual cat I asked you for, so all's good .EDIT: Also, Lua escaping, ooops. Last edited by NiLuJe; 07-01-2018 at 11:15 AM. |
|
|
|
|
|
#27 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
@7hir7een: Hmm, quick question, what's the default mapping for the top button? Backward or Forward?
(I'm looking at a K4 and it was Backward, but looking at the KOA code and what you've logged, it looks like Forward, unless they inverted the keycode between the KOA and the KOA2...) EDIT: Looked at the KOA2 user's guide, it's indeed in the reverse order than on a K2/K3/K4, so, all's good . (i.e., top is forward).
Last edited by NiLuJe; 07-01-2018 at 11:28 AM. |
|
|
|
|
|
#28 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
OTA 1753 is out and features the result of this latest batch of changes
.
|
|
|
|
|
|
#29 |
|
Reader of Books
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 249
Karma: 178096
Join Date: Oct 2012
Device: Kobo Libra Colour, Clara Colour, Libra 2, Elipsa
|
No go, unfortunately. I can't really see anything different in the crash log, but it's freezing on a blank screen as before when attempting to start the filemanager.
Is there some way to get more in-depth feedback from terminal, maybe? |
|
|
|
|
|
#30 |
|
BLAM!
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 13,506
Karma: 26047202
Join Date: Jun 2010
Location: Paris, France
Device: Kindle 2i, 3g, 4, 5w, PW, PW2, PW5; Kobo H2O, Forma, Elipsa, Sage, C2E
|
@7hir7een:
Hmm. You can try debug mode, see if something better pops up in the logs that way... In koreader/koreader.sh, switch ./reader.lua to ./reader.lua -d (c.f., https://github.com/koreader/koreader...reader.sh#L236) (with a decent text/code editor that won't mangle *nix line endings). And on the off-chance I messed that up, does the path /sys/class/backlight/max77796-bl/brightness actually point to something? EDIT: As for terminal output, I guess our best friend strace might be of help again... ![]() Code:
strace -fitv -p $(pidof reader.lua | sed -e 's/ / -p /g') Last edited by NiLuJe; 07-01-2018 at 01:51 PM. |
|
|
|
![]() |
| Tags |
| koa2, koreader |
| Thread Tools | Search this Thread |
|
Similar Threads
|
||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| KOA2 KOA2 jail break | knc1 | Kindle Developer's Corner | 470 | 07-03-2020 01:28 AM |
| KOA2 getting hot in the sun | Lady Stardust | Amazon Kindle | 17 | 08-20-2018 06:58 PM |
| Accessories unofficial accessory of my KOA2 | N31welt | Amazon Kindle | 0 | 01-01-2018 04:55 AM |
| KOA2 question about KOA2 storage | fllc | Kindle Developer's Corner | 2 | 11-25-2017 03:18 AM |
| KOA2 KOA2 USB mount | j.p.s | Kindle Developer's Corner | 8 | 11-02-2017 11:36 AM |